Cytek Biosciences operates in the life sciences technology sector, specializing in cell analysis instrumentation. The company's business model revolves around the design, manufacture, and sale of its proprietary flow cytometry systems, which are instruments used by scientists and clinicians to analyze the characteristics of individual cells. Cytek's core innovation is its Full Spectrum Profiling (FSP™) technology, a significant advancement over conventional flow cytometry. This technology captures the full emission spectrum of fluorescent markers, allowing for the analysis of a much larger number of cellular characteristics simultaneously (high-parameter analysis) with greater flexibility and resolution. The company's strategy is a classic “razor-and-blade” model: it sells the primary instruments (the “razor”) and then generates high-margin, recurring revenue from the sale of proprietary reagents and consumables (the “blades”), as well as ongoing service contracts. Its primary customers are academic research institutions, pharmaceutical and biotechnology companies, and clinical research organizations that require sophisticated tools for immunology, oncology, and other areas of cell biology research.

Cytek's flagship products are its instrument systems, including the Aurora and Northern Lights series. These instruments are the foundation of its business, accounting for approximately 69% of total revenue in 2023, or around $137.9 million. These systems are the physical hardware that incorporates the FSP technology, enabling researchers to conduct complex cell analysis experiments. The global flow cytometry market was valued at around $4.8 billion in 2023 and is projected to grow at a Compound Annual Growth Rate (CAGR) of approximately 8%. Competition in this space is intense, dominated by established giants like Becton, Dickinson and Company (BD) with its FACSLyric and FACSymphony platforms, and Beckman Coulter (part of Danaher) with its CytoFLEX systems. Cytek's instruments differentiate themselves by enabling the use of over 40 different colors (fluorescent markers) simultaneously, a significant leap from the 20-30 parameters often seen in conventional systems, thus providing deeper biological insights from a single sample. The primary consumers are research laboratories in universities and biotech firms, which make a significant capital investment ranging from $250,000 to over $500,000 per instrument. Once a lab purchases a Cytek system, they invest heavily in training personnel, developing experimental protocols (panels), and building datasets around the SpectroFlo software, creating substantial switching costs. This technological differentiation and the resulting customer investment form the core moat for this product line, though the company remains vulnerable to the massive sales and distribution networks of its larger competitors.

Following the instrument sale, Cytek's reagent and consumable business generates a steady stream of recurring revenue, contributing roughly 21% of total sales in 2023, or $41.8 million. This segment includes a growing portfolio of proprietary cFluor™ reagents, which are optimized for use with the FSP systems, as well as ancillary consumables. The market for flow cytometry reagents is a multi-billion dollar segment of the broader market, with high gross margins typically exceeding 60-70%. Here, Cytek competes not only with instrument manufacturers like BD and Beckman Coulter, who have vast reagent catalogs, but also with specialized reagent suppliers like Bio-Techne and BioLegend (now part of PerkinElmer). Cytek's key advantage is the synergy between its instruments and reagents; while its systems are compatible with third-party reagents, its own cFluor™ products are designed to maximize the performance of the FSP platform. The customers are the existing installed base of over 1,700 Cytek instruments. The stickiness is extremely high, as labs performing validated, long-term studies prefer to use a consistent and optimized source of reagents to ensure data quality and reproducibility. This creates a powerful and predictable revenue stream, strengthening the company's moat. The competitive moat here is the classic razor-blade model, where the initial instrument sale locks in a long tail of high-margin, consumable sales, creating a durable and profitable customer relationship.

Finally, Cytek's service and software offerings, which accounted for 10% of 2023 revenue ($20.0 million), are critical for cementing its competitive position. The company's proprietary SpectroFlo® software is the brain of the FSP system, controlling data acquisition and simplifying the complex analysis required for high-parameter experiments. This software is a key part of the value proposition, as it is designed to be more intuitive than many competing analysis platforms. Services include installation, training, and multi-year maintenance contracts that provide technical support and preventative maintenance, ensuring the high-value instruments remain operational. The customer for these services is every lab that purchases an instrument. Stickiness is exceptionally high for the software, as all experimental data and analysis workflows are generated and stored within this proprietary ecosystem, making it difficult and costly for a lab to switch to a competitor's platform without losing historical data and expertise. Service contracts also generate recurring revenue and deepen the customer relationship. The moat for this segment is built on high switching costs related to software integration, user training, and data dependency. By controlling the entire workflow from sample acquisition to data analysis, Cytek creates a tightly integrated ecosystem that is difficult for customers to leave and for competitors to penetrate.

In conclusion, Cytek's business model is built on a strong foundation of technological innovation that translates directly into a durable competitive advantage. The FSP platform is not just an incremental improvement; it represents a step-change in the capabilities of flow cytometry, giving the company a genuine performance edge that attracts customers. This technological advantage is then fortified by a classic and effective razor-and-blade model, which creates high-margin, recurring revenues from reagents and services. The most significant source of Cytek's moat is the high switching costs created by its integrated ecosystem. A lab that adopts the Cytek platform invests significant capital in the instrument, time in training, and intellectual energy in developing workflows and analyzing data with the SpectroFlo software. Migrating to a different platform would mean abandoning this entire investment, a costly and disruptive proposition.

However, the durability of this moat is not absolute. Cytek is a relatively small player in a market dominated by large, well-funded competitors like BD and Danaher. These companies have extensive global sales forces, massive R&D budgets, and entrenched customer relationships that Cytek cannot match. The primary risk is that these competitors could eventually develop similar full-spectrum technology, neutralizing Cytek's key differentiator. Furthermore, Cytek's manufacturing scale is smaller, making it potentially more vulnerable to supply chain disruptions and providing fewer economies of scale. Therefore, while the company's current moat is strong, its long-term resilience depends on its ability to continue innovating and rapidly expand its installed base to solidify its market position before the giants of the industry can fully catch up. The business model is sound and resilient, but the competitive environment requires flawless execution.

A detailed look at Cytek's financial statements reveals a company with a fortress-like balance sheet but struggling operations. For its latest fiscal year, the company reported modest revenue growth of 3.85%, but this has reversed into declines of 7.59% and 2.18% in the first two quarters of the current year. This slowdown is concerning and has severely impacted profitability. Gross margins, while still over 50%, have compressed from the 55.4% seen last year, and operating margins have collapsed to deeply negative territory (-23.3% in the last quarter), indicating that operating expenses are far too high for the current level of sales.

The primary strength in Cytek's financial picture is its balance sheet and liquidity. As of the most recent quarter, the company holds $262 million in cash and short-term investments, while total debt is a minimal $23.7 million. This results in a very strong net cash position and a current ratio of 5.23, which means it has more than five times the current assets needed to cover its short-term liabilities. This financial cushion gives the company significant runway and flexibility to navigate its operational challenges without needing to raise capital or take on excessive debt in the near term.

However, the company's profitability and cash generation are significant red flags. Cytek is consistently losing money, with a net loss of $5.58 million in the last quarter and $11.4 million in the quarter before that. More alarmingly, after generating positive free cash flow of $21.85 million for the full prior year, the company has started burning cash in the last two quarters. This shift from generating cash to consuming it is a critical negative development. In summary, while the company's strong cash position prevents an immediate crisis, its financial foundation is being eroded by poor operational performance, making it a high-risk investment from a financial statement perspective.

Analyzing Cytek Biosciences' performance over the last five fiscal years (FY2020-FY2024) reveals a tale of two conflicting trends: rapid sales growth and a simultaneous collapse in profitability. The company has successfully expanded its market presence, a testament to its technology. However, its inability to translate this expansion into sustainable earnings or consistent cash flow raises significant questions about its operational efficiency and long-term business model.

From a growth perspective, Cytek's record is strong. Revenue grew from $92.8 million in FY2020 to $200.5 million in FY2024, representing a compound annual growth rate (CAGR) of 21.2%. This indicates successful commercial execution and market adoption of its products. However, this growth story is undermined by a severe decline in profitability. Operating margins, which were a positive 14.7% in FY2020, plummeted into negative territory, ending at -11.5% in FY2024. This resulted in net losses in the last two fiscal years (-$12.15 million in FY2023 and -$6.02 million in FY2024), a stark reversal from profitability in FY2020 and FY2021.

The company's cash flow history is marked by extreme volatility, preventing any sense of financial predictability. Free cash flow (FCF) swung from $13.6 million in FY2020 to -$22 million in FY2022, before recovering to $21.9 million in FY2024. This erratic performance makes it difficult to rely on the company's ability to self-fund its operations consistently. In terms of shareholder returns, Cytek does not pay a dividend. While it has recently initiated share buybacks, its stock performance has been characterized by high volatility (beta of 1.32) and significant declines from its peak, delivering poor risk-adjusted returns compared to stable industry peers.

In conclusion, Cytek's historical record does not inspire confidence in its financial execution or resilience. While the company has proven it can grow its sales, it has failed to manage costs and scale its operations profitably. The deteriorating margins and inconsistent cash flow are major red flags that suggest the business model, in its current form, is not sustainable. Compared to competitors who deliver steady, profitable growth, Cytek's past performance is that of a high-risk venture where the risks have become more apparent than the rewards.

The market for cell analysis, specifically flow cytometry, is undergoing a significant technological shift that directly benefits Cytek Biosciences. The global flow cytometry market, valued at approximately $4.8 billion in 2023, is projected to grow at a Compound Annual Growth Rate (CAGR) of around 8%, reaching over $7 billion by 2028. The most crucial trend within this market is the move from low-parameter to high-parameter analysis, where researchers seek to extract more data from a single cell sample. This shift is driven by the increasing complexity of biological research in areas like immuno-oncology, which requires detailed profiling of the tumor microenvironment, and the development of cell and gene therapies, which demand precise characterization of cellular products. These advanced applications are creating a demand ceiling for conventional cytometers, opening the door for innovative platforms like Cytek's.

Catalysts for increased demand over the next 3-5 years include continued government and private funding for cancer and immunology research, as well as regulatory approvals for new cell-based therapeutics that will standardize the need for high-content cell analysis in both development and manufacturing quality control. While the market is growing, competitive intensity remains high. However, the technological barrier to entry is rising. Developing a full-spectrum flow cytometry system requires deep expertise in optics, electronics, fluidics, and complex software algorithms. Furthermore, the industry's “razor-and-blade” business model creates high switching costs, making it difficult for new entrants to displace established players who have a large installed base of instruments. This dynamic favors innovators like Cytek who can establish a technological beachhead and lock in customers.

Cytek’s primary growth engine is its portfolio of instruments, including the Aurora and Northern Lights systems. Currently, these instruments are primarily consumed by academic research institutions and biotechnology companies engaged in complex discovery work. The main factor limiting consumption today is the high upfront capital cost, which can range from $250,000 to over $500,000, and the learning curve associated with adopting a new, advanced technology. Over the next 3-5 years, consumption is expected to increase significantly as more laboratories upgrade from conventional, parameter-limited systems to meet the demands of modern research. Growth will be driven by converting competitors' customers, entering new geographic markets (especially in the Asia-Pacific region), and, most importantly, expanding into the clinical diagnostics space. A key catalyst will be the launch of new instruments, such as the company's FSP-based cell sorter, which opens up an entirely new market segment. In the competitive landscape, customers often choose established players like Becton Dickinson (BD) or Beckman Coulter for their brand reputation, extensive service networks, and integration with existing laboratory workflows. Cytek outperforms and wins customers when the primary purchasing driver is technological capability—specifically, the need to conduct novel, high-parameter experiments that are simply not possible on competing platforms. The number of companies in the high-end instrument space is small and likely to remain so due to the immense R&D costs and scale required. A key risk for Cytek is a competitor launching a rival full-spectrum platform, which would erode its primary technological advantage. The probability of this is medium, as competitors are undoubtedly working on similar technologies. A second risk is a potential slowdown in R&D funding for biotech, which could delay capital equipment purchases by its core customer base, with a medium probability.

The second pillar of Cytek’s growth is its recurring revenue from reagents and consumables, driven by its proprietary cFluor™ line. Current consumption is directly tied to the utilization of its installed base of over 1,700 instruments. A key constraint is the open nature of the platform; customers are not required to use Cytek’s reagents and can purchase them from a wide array of third-party suppliers. In the next 3-5 years, reagent consumption will grow in lockstep with the expansion of the instrument installed base. Cytek’s strategy to accelerate this growth is two-fold: first, to increase the attach rate (the percentage of reagent spend per instrument that goes to Cytek) by expanding its catalog of optimized cFluor™ reagents, and second, by offering pre-configured reagent panels that simplify complex experimental setups for customers. The market for flow cytometry reagents is highly competitive, featuring giants like BD and specialized, high-quality suppliers like BioLegend (now part of PerkinElmer) and Bio-Techne. Customers often choose based on a combination of price, quality, and the availability of a specific antibody for their target of interest. Cytek wins share by providing a fully integrated solution where its reagents are guaranteed to perform optimally with its instruments and software, saving researchers valuable time on validation and troubleshooting. The industry structure for reagents is more fragmented than for instruments, though it is undergoing consolidation. The primary risk for Cytek in this segment is pricing pressure and bundling from large competitors who can leverage their vast reagent catalogs to offer discounts. The probability of this is high. A lower probability risk would be a significant quality control failure in a popular reagent line, which could damage customer trust in the ecosystem.

Cytek's software (SpectroFlo®) and services are the glue that creates a sticky ecosystem, but the largest untapped growth opportunity lies in leveraging this entire platform for the clinical diagnostics market. Currently, nearly all of Cytek's revenue comes from the Research Use Only (RUO) market. While this is a sizable market, it is dwarfed by the multi-billion dollar clinical diagnostics market, which offers more stable, recurring revenue streams tied to patient testing volumes rather than cyclical research budgets. The primary constraint today is regulatory; Cytek's systems are not yet cleared by the FDA for diagnostic use. Over the next 3-5 years, the most significant change in consumption will be the potential entry into this clinical market. This requires securing 510(k) clearance from the FDA for both an instrument and specific diagnostic assays (e.g., for leukemia and lymphoma immunophenotyping). A successful entry would dramatically expand Cytek’s addressable market and accelerate revenue growth. The key catalyst is achieving the first FDA clearance, which would validate the platform for clinical use. Competition in the clinical space is even more concentrated, with BD and Beckman Coulter holding dominant positions built over decades. To win, Cytek must prove that its technology not only provides superior clinical data but is also robust, reliable, and easy to operate in a routine high-throughput clinical lab environment. The barriers to entry are extremely high due to stringent regulatory requirements and the need for a dedicated clinical sales and support infrastructure. A major future risk for Cytek is a delay or outright failure in obtaining these crucial FDA clearances, which would cap its growth potential. The probability of encountering regulatory hurdles is medium. A related risk is the challenge of building a commercial organization that can effectively compete with the entrenched sales forces of its giant competitors in the hospital and clinical lab space, which also carries a medium probability.

Beyond product-specific growth, Cytek's future expansion will also depend on its go-to-market strategy. The company is actively expanding its commercial footprint globally, with a particular focus on the fast-growing Asia-Pacific life sciences market. This geographic expansion provides a straightforward path to growing its installed base and accessing new customer segments. Another significant long-term opportunity lies in forming strategic partnerships with pharmaceutical companies. Cytek's platform is an ideal tool for developing companion diagnostics, which are tests used to determine a patient's eligibility for a specific, often high-cost, therapy. Securing a partnership with a major pharmaceutical company to co-develop such a diagnostic would provide a major validation of its technology and create a dedicated, high-volume revenue stream. Finally, the company's internal R&D efforts to apply its FSP technology to adjacent applications, such as cell sorting, will be critical. The launch of a cell sorter diversifies its product portfolio and allows it to capture a greater share of the lab's capital equipment budget, further solidifying its position within its customer base.

As of October 30, 2025, at a price of $3.82, Cytek Biosciences presents a mixed but compelling valuation case, suggesting the stock is trading below its intrinsic value. The undervaluation argument is primarily built on the company's strong asset base and low revenue multiples, which must be weighed against its current lack of profitability. The analysis points to an estimated fair value range of $4.50–$5.50, representing a potential upside of approximately 31% from the current price, making it an attractive entry point for investors with a tolerance for risk.

A multiples-based approach is challenging due to negative earnings (TTM EPS of -$0.05), rendering P/E and EV/EBITDA ratios meaningless. Instead, sales- and asset-based multiples are more relevant. The company's EV/Sales ratio is a low 1.26, significantly below the US Life Sciences industry average of 3.4x. Applying a conservative 2.0x multiple to its TTM revenue suggests a fair value of around $4.96 per share. Similarly, its Price-to-Book ratio of 1.29 is well below the typical healthcare sector range of 3.0 to 6.0, implying a fair value of approximately $4.46 per share even with a modest 1.5x multiple.

The company's cash flow and asset positions provide further context. Cytek reports a modest TTM Free Cash Flow Yield of 2.24%, but this signal is weak as cash flow turned negative in the first half of 2025, making a discounted cash flow valuation unreliable. The core strength of the valuation case lies in its asset base. The company holds $238.34 million in net cash, which equates to $1.87 per share. This means a substantial portion of the $3.82 stock price is backed by cash and tangible assets, providing a strong margin of safety and a valuation floor for investors.

By triangulating these methods, the valuation is most heavily weighted toward asset- and sales-based approaches due to the instability in earnings and cash flow. The EV/Sales multiple suggests a value near $4.96, while the P/B ratio points to a value around $4.46. This analysis supports a final estimated fair value range of $4.50 to $5.50. The conclusion is that the company appears undervalued based on its strong balance sheet and discounted valuation multiples relative to both its own history and sector peers.

Cytek Biosciences positions itself as a technological disruptor in the established and scientifically critical field of cell analysis. The company's core competitive advantage lies in its proprietary Full Spectrum Profiling (FSP™) technology, which underpins its Aurora and Northern Lights flow cytometry systems. Unlike traditional flow cytometry that captures a narrow portion of the light spectrum from fluorescent markers, Cytek's FSP captures the entire spectrum, allowing researchers to extract significantly more data from a single sample. This enables more complex experiments and deeper biological insights, a compelling value proposition for academic, biopharma, and clinical research customers pushing the boundaries of science.

The company operates in a classic 'David vs. Goliath' competitive environment. The flow cytometry market has long been dominated by a few large, well-capitalized companies such as Becton Dickinson (BD), Danaher (via its Beckman Coulter subsidiary), and Thermo Fisher Scientific. These incumbents benefit from decades of brand recognition, enormous installed instrument bases, and deep, long-standing relationships with customers. Cytek's strategy is not to compete on price or scale but on performance, targeting sophisticated users who require the advanced capabilities that FSP technology offers. Its success depends on convincing these key opinion leaders and high-impact labs to adopt its platform, thereby building credibility and driving broader market acceptance.

From a financial perspective, Cytek fits the profile of an emerging growth company. It has demonstrated strong top-line revenue growth as it expands its installed base of instruments. This is crucial because the business model is built on the 'razor-and-blade' strategy, where initial instrument sales lead to a long tail of high-margin, recurring revenue from proprietary reagents, consumables, and service contracts. However, this growth has come at the cost of profitability. The company invests heavily in research and development to maintain its technological edge and in sales and marketing to build its commercial footprint, resulting in periods of operating losses and negative cash flow. The key challenge for Cytek is to manage this growth trajectory effectively, scaling its operations to the point where the recurring revenue base can support a profitable and sustainable business model.

The investment thesis for Cytek is therefore a bet on its technological moat and its ability to execute its commercial strategy. The opportunity is substantial if FSP becomes a new standard in high-complexity cell analysis. However, the risks are equally significant. The incumbent competitors have vast resources to respond to Cytek's threat, either by developing their own competing technologies or by leveraging their market power to limit Cytek's penetration. Furthermore, as a smaller company, Cytek is more vulnerable to economic downturns that might slow capital equipment purchases by its customer base. Investors must weigh the potential for high returns driven by technological disruption against the inherent uncertainties of a small company challenging established market leaders.

    As a smaller, high-growth company, Cytek lacks the manufacturing scale and supply chain redundancy of its larger competitors, creating potential risks in sourcing and production capacity.

    Compared to industry giants like Becton Dickinson or Danaher, Cytek's manufacturing footprint is significantly smaller. The company relies heavily on its primary facility in Fremont, California, for instrument assembly. Its 2023 10-K report acknowledges reliance on single-source suppliers for certain critical components, which poses a meaningful risk to production in the event of a supply chain disruption. While the company has managed its growth effectively to date, its inventory days are relatively high as it scales up, and it does not possess the economies of scale or redundant manufacturing sites that protect larger players from operational shocks. This lack of scale is a notable weakness, making its operations less resilient and potentially limiting its ability to meet sudden surges in demand or navigate supply chain crises as effectively as its multi-billion dollar competitors.

    Cytek is successfully executing a classic 'razor-and-blade' model, with a rapidly growing installed base of over `1,700` instruments driving recurring, high-margin consumable revenue and creating significant customer switching costs.

    Cytek’s moat is heavily reliant on the stickiness of its installed base. As of early 2024, the company had placed over 1,700 of its FSP systems globally, a number that has grown consistently year-over-year. Each instrument sale creates a long-term revenue stream from consumables (reagents) and services, which together accounted for over 30% of total revenue in 2023. This demonstrates a strong reagent attach rate, where customers who buy the instrument continue to buy the proprietary consumables. This model creates high switching costs, as labs build entire research workflows, standard operating procedures, and long-term studies around Cytek's platform. Migrating to a competitor would require not just a new capital expenditure but also re-training staff and re-validating experiments, a costly and time-consuming process that most labs are unwilling to undertake. This growing, locked-in customer base provides excellent revenue visibility and a durable competitive advantage.

  • Menu Breadth And Usage

    Pass

    Cytek's Full Spectrum Profiling technology offers a paradigm shift in 'menu breadth' by allowing researchers to use an unprecedented number of markers simultaneously, providing a key advantage over conventional systems.

    While a traditional measure of menu breadth is the sheer number of available tests or assays, Cytek's strength lies in the technical capability of its platform. The FSP technology enables researchers to design highly complex experiments, or 'panels,' using 40 or more fluorescent markers at once from a single sample. This is a significant leap from conventional flow cytometers, which are often limited to 20-30 parameters. This capability effectively expands the 'menu' of questions a scientist can ask from a single, precious sample. The company is also actively expanding its proprietary cFluor™ reagent portfolio to support this high-parameter capability. This technological edge in multiplexing boosts the utility and throughput of each instrument, allowing labs to generate richer datasets more efficiently. This unique capability is a core part of Cytek's value proposition and a strong competitive differentiator.

    Cytek is currently demonstrating severe negative operating leverage, meaning its profits are falling much faster than its sales. The company's operating margin has worsened from -11.54% in the last fiscal year to a deeply negative -23.3% in the most recent quarter. This is because operating expenses remain high even as revenue declines. Selling, General & Admin (SG&A) expenses consumed 56.3% of revenue in the last quarter, while Research & Development (R&D) took another 19.4%. Combined, these costs far exceed the company's gross profit, leading to substantial operating losses and showing that the current business model is not scalable or profitable.

    Cytek's earnings and margin history shows a clear and troubling negative trend. In FY2020, the company was profitable with a 14.7% operating margin and positive net income. However, profitability has eroded consistently since then. The operating margin fell to 7.2% in FY2021, -1.1% in FY2022, -14.4% in FY2023, and ended at -11.5% in FY2024. This indicates that operating expenses have grown much faster than revenue, a sign of poor cost control. Consequently, net income swung from a profit of $19.4 million in FY2020 to a loss of -$6.0 million in FY2024. This sustained deterioration in profitability signals fundamental issues with the company's ability to scale efficiently, a stark contrast to highly profitable competitors like Danaher and Becton Dickinson.

  • FCF And Capital Returns

    Fail

    Free cash flow has been extremely volatile and unpredictable, including a significant negative year in FY2022, and the company offers no dividends to shareholders.

    A review of Cytek's cash flow history reveals a lack of consistency, which is a significant weakness. Over the past five years, free cash flow has been erratic: $13.6M (FY20), $0.3M (FY21), -$22.0M (FY22), $0.6M (FY23), and $21.9M (FY24). The negative cash flow in FY2022 shows that the business could not fund its own operations and investments. While the recovery in FY2024 is positive, the overall pattern is one of unreliability. Furthermore, Cytek does not pay a dividend, offering no income return to shareholders. While the company has recently repurchased shares (-$22.2M in FY24), this is not enough to offset the fundamental weakness of inconsistent cash generation, which is a key measure of a healthy business.

The primary macroeconomic risk for Cytek stems from its reliance on customers whose funding is sensitive to economic cycles. Academic institutions, biotech firms, and pharmaceutical companies purchase Cytek's expensive cell analysis instruments, which are considered capital expenditures. In times of high interest rates or economic uncertainty, funding for scientific research can tighten significantly, causing potential customers to delay or cancel purchases. The biotech sector, in particular, has faced a challenging funding environment recently, which directly pressures demand for Cytek's high-end equipment and could lead to lumpy and unpredictable revenue streams in the coming years.

The life sciences tools industry is intensely competitive and dominated by large, well-capitalized companies. Cytek's main competitors, including Becton Dickinson, Beckman Coulter (a Danaher company), and Thermo Fisher Scientific, possess significant advantages in scale, brand recognition, and global sales infrastructure. These giants can often bundle products and services, offering discounts that a smaller, more focused company like Cytek cannot match. While Cytek's Full Spectrum Profiling (FSP™) technology provides a strong competitive advantage today, the risk of technological obsolescence is ever-present. Competitors are actively developing new technologies, and a breakthrough by another company could quickly erode Cytek's market position.

From a company-specific standpoint, Cytek's most significant challenge is its path to sustained profitability. The company has a history of net losses, including a reported net loss of $(5.1) million in the first quarter of 2024, as it invests heavily in research and development and expanding its commercial operations. This spending is necessary to compete but also puts pressure on its financial performance. Furthermore, its revenue is heavily concentrated on its Aurora and Northern Lights instrument lines. Any issues with these products, a shift in market preference, or a successful competing product launch could disproportionately impact the company's financial health. Managing the complexities of a global supply chain for these sophisticated instruments also presents an ongoing operational risk that could affect production and delivery schedules.
